Abstract |
This adaptable animal is widespread and common in Singapore. It can be found in urban areas and is known to inhabit gardens and roof spaces (Baker & Lim, 2012: 152). The common palm civet, Paradoxurus hermaphroditus, has been split into three species by a recent study (Veron et al., 2014). The name Paradoxurus hermaphroditus is restricted to the populations in India, southern China and Indo-china (henceforth as Indian palm civet). The form in Singapore, peninsular Malaysia, Sumatra and Java is Paradoxurus musangus (Sumatran palm civet), named by Sir Stamford Raffles in 1821 as Viverra musanga based on animals from Sumatra. Those in Borneo and the Philippines are Paradoxurus philippinensis (Philippine palm civet). |

Abstract |
The Sumatran spitting cobra is a relatively common venomous snake in Singapore, occurring in forest, scrubland, gardens and around human habitation. It is known to feed on rats and toads and other small vertebrates (Baker & Lim, 2012: 117; Das, 2010: 317). The featured prey is identified as a Malaysian wood rat (Rattus tiomanicus) on the basis of its distinctly white underparts and the mangrove habitat. In Singapore, this species of rat inhabits secondary forest, scrubland, plantations and mangroves (Baker & Lim, 2012: 141). |
